One of the biggest myths is that players can stick to short, controlled sessions. The reality? Average sessions drift 30% longer than intended when timed. Platforms use subtle nudges, like placing «spin again» buttons prominently or hiding clocks. A case study on Megaways slots revealed that a player aiming for a 15-minute session stayed for 47 minutes. This isn’t accidental—it’s design. Without logging every start time, most players underestimate how long they’ve been spinning. And the longer you play, the harder it is to break even, even with a high RTP (return to player). For example, a 96% RTP slot still sees players lose $4 per $100 wagered over time—but extended play compounds this. Five hours of continuous spins at $1 per bet translates to an expected loss of $60, yet players often mistake RTP for session-level protection.
Fast payouts—but phantom withdrawal limits
Platforms like Stake.com advertise 48-hour cashouts, but the fine print reveals hurdles you didn’t expect. Withdrawals often require 5+ verification steps, and caps like $2k/week are hidden in bonus terms and conditions. Worse, some platforms lock a significant portion of winnings as «bonus money.» One user reported that 73% of their winnings were inaccessible due to playthrough requirements. These limits aren’t just inconvenient—they’re designed to push you back into the game, especially if you’re on a Curacao license platform with fewer regulations. A comparative analysis showed Curacao-licensed casinos process withdrawals 58% slower than those under MGA or UKGC oversight. Even «instant» crypto payouts often bottleneck at identity checks, with 22% of users reporting delays exceeding 72 hours despite blockchain confirmations completing in minutes.
43% of bonuses expire mid-session
Bonuses are a major draw, but they come with strings tighter than most players realize. Countdown timers often start at deposit, not first use, and 43% of bonuses expire mid-session. Some «free spins» require 30x playthroughs on specific slots, making them nearly impossible to cash out. One user lost a $50 bonus during a 2-minute bathroom break because the timer ran out. Twitch streamers, who often play for hours, are disproportionately affected by these mechanics. Bonus terms can also change post-deposit, leaving players with unexpected restrictions. For instance, a «100% match up to $500» offer might retroactively apply a maximum win cap of 10x the bonus amount—meaning a $500 bonus can’t yield more than $5,000 regardless of gameplay outcomes. This contradicts the initial marketing and exploits cognitive dissonance in players who’ve already committed funds.
Turbo spins and attention decay
Many platforms default to turbo spins—250+ per hour—to accelerate play. Unlike live dealer games, which have natural pauses, turbo spins offer no “loss brakes.” Data shows that players betting every 1.4 seconds lose three times faster than those on standard settings. The rapid pace also dulls attention, making it harder to track losses. Even apps with «time spent» counters exclude loading screens, skewing players’ perception of how long they’ve been playing. Turbo spins aren’t just an option—they’re a trap. Neuroimaging studies reveal that speeds above 180 spins/hour reduce prefrontal cortex engagement by 63%, shifting decision-making to impulse-driven brain regions. Platforms exploit this by auto-selecting turbo mode for 78% of new users while burying standard speed options in submenus.
When the app disables your logout button
Dark patterns go beyond button placement. Some platforms disable logout buttons during streaks or collapse cashier tabs to keep players engaged. Exit modals often delay logouts, while live chat responses are slower than deposit processing. One player printed 80 pages of chat logs to dispute a $200 bonus tied to these mechanics. A simple workaround? Always use the browser version, which allows forced exits. But few players realize this until it’s too late. The lesson: these platforms are designed to keep you in, even when you’re ready to leave. Behavioral analytics from one platform showed that players experiencing a «near-miss» (e.g., two jackpot symbols) were 40% more likely to encounter a frozen UI element preventing session termination—a tactic eerily reminiscent of Skinner box operant conditioning experiments with variable-ratio reinforcement schedules.
